poj 3094 Quicksum
除了這道題真的很水,我好像也不能說別的什麼了吧。。。哈哈哈,注意一下控製一下循環的細節就好,一個連乘的累加
#include <stdio.h>
#include <string.h>
int main()
{
char str[300];
int sum,pos;
while(gets(str))
{
if(str[0]=='#')
break;
//計算quicksum值
pos=0;
sum=0;
while(str[pos]!='\0')
{
if(str[pos]==' ')
pos++;
else
{
sum+=(pos+1)*(str[pos]-'A'+1);
pos++;
}
}
printf("%d\n",sum);
}
return 0;
}
最後更新:2017-04-03 14:53:38